Convert Handwritten Notes to Editable Text in Minutes—No Software Needed
Typing up handwritten notes and old letters can be tedious and time-consuming. Thankfully, you can now turn your scans or photos into editable text using a free browser-based OCR tool—no installation required. Here’s a quick step-by-step guide: 1. Scan or photograph your notes in good lighting with clear contrast. 2. Open a free online OCR service in your browser. 3. Upload your image and crop the area you need. 4. Click “Convert” and wait a few seconds. 5. Copy or download the extracted text, then proofread for any minor errors.
